You’d be hard-pressed to find anyone outside of Toyota who’d call the new 2021 RAV4 Prime PHEV a “sporty” car. Even so, you’d expect Toyota’s team of brilliant and dedicated engineers to keep it from ending up at the bottom of the performance barrel in the compact SUV/crossover class it usually finds itself in. I mean, you’d expect that, but the RAV4 Prime scandalously failed Sweden’s famous “moose avoidance test”…
